When Microsoft launched Windows 10 in 2015, it revolutionised the operating system landscape with its modern interface, enhanced versatility, and intuitive user experience.

But every technology lifecycle has its conclusion. On October 14, 2025, Windows 10 will officially reach its end-of-life, marking the end of an era for this trusted platform.

What Does Windows 10 End-of-life Mean for Your Business?

When Windows 10 reaches its end-of-life (EOL) date, Microsoft will discontinue all regular updates, security patches, and technical support that have been automatically delivered to your systems.

While Windows 10 will still function normally, your business will no longer receive the essential updates needed to protect against emerging security threats or improve system performance.

Windows 10 EOL Support FAQs

Is my computer compatible with Windows 11?

You can check if your device is compatible with Windows 10 by contacting our experts at Croft or by using Microsoft’s PC Health Check app.

Is the upgrade from Windows 10 to Windows 11 free?

If you have a genuine copy of Windows 10, the upgrade to Windows 11 is free. This said, we advise working with a Microsoft Partner, like Croft, to review your software requirements. Deploying the Windows 11 upgrade may carry additional costs for upgrading hardware and software to meet its specifications.

What happens if I don't upgrade to Windows 11?

If you don’t upgrade to Windows 11, your device will become more vulnerable to security risks, compliance issues, lack of support, and performance or compatibility problems that could increase overall costs.

Will I lose my data if I upgrade to Windows 11?

If you upgrade to Windows 11, you will not lose your data, but we would advise that you have a robust backup and recovery process in place to ensure you could access your data if a catastrophic event happened. Using an unsupported system like Windows 10 can increase the risk of data loss due to unpatched security vulnerabilities.

Will all my systems and applications work on Windows 11?

The majority of apps and systems that function on Windows 10 will run on Windows 11. However, there will be some exceptions, so it is important to check with a Microsoft provider, like Croft, to ensure compatibility before you start your upgrade journey.
